昆明山海棠碱诱导Jurkat淋巴瘤细胞膜磷脂酰丝氨酸外翻及瘤细胞超微结构改变的研究

摘    要:目的 检测昆明山海棠碱(THH碱)诱导Jurkat T淋巴瘤细胞的凋亡效应。方法 THH碱多剂量多时间点诱导Jurkat T淋巴瘤细胞细胞后,采用Annexin-V-Fluorescence标记膜外翻磷脂酰丝氨酸(Phosphatidylserine,PS)的凋亡细胞,同时荧光素PI标记坏死细胞,流式细胞术检测分别检测其阳性细胞率。同时采用判断凋亡发生的“金标准”——形态学观察方法观察其超微结构的改变。结果 THH碱诱导后磷脂酰丝氨酸外翻的细胞显著增加,有明显的时间和剂量相关性,超微结构观察可见大量细胞明显发生细胞体积缩小、核固缩、胞浆浓缩、凋亡小体形成等凋亡典型的形态特征。结论 THH碱能非常显著地诱导Jurkat T淋巴瘤细胞发生凋亡。

Tripterygium Hypoglaucum (Levl) Hutch alkaloids induce the translocation of phosphatidylserine and ultrastructural changes of Jurkat T lymphoma cells

Abstract:Objective To detect the apoptotic effect of Tripterygium Hypoglaucum(Levl) Hutch (THH) alkaloids on Jurkat T lymphoma cells. Methods After Jurkat cells were induced by THH alkaloids at different time points and different concentrations, translocated phosphatidylserine(PS) was labeled with Annexin V Fluorescence and the dead cells labeled with propidium iodide(PI). PS translocated cells and dead cells were measured with flow cytometry. The morphological changes, including ultrastructural changes, were observed. Results THH alkaloids could effectively induce the translocation of phosphatidylserine in time and dose dependent manners. Observation of the ultrastructural changes showed that there were a series of typical apoptotic changes, including decreased cell volume, apoptotic bodies, pyknosis and condensed cytoplasm. Conclusion THH alkaloids can effectively induce the apoptosis of Jurkat T lymphoma cells.
